What prefabricated houses offer
For homeowners seeking efficiency and speed, prefabricated houses present a practical solution. Offsite construction allows components to be built in controlled environments, reducing weather delays and on-site disruption. This approach supports tighter budgets and predictable timelines, while maintaining quality standards. Costs and long term value
Pricing for prefabricated houses can be straightforward, with clear line items covering design, materials, and assembly. Savings often arise from reduced on-site labour, shorter construction periods, and shorter disruption to neighbouring properties. Consumers should account for delivery, crane access, and foundation work when budgeting. In many regions, local permits and regulatory compliance are easier to navigate with modular builds, contributing to a smoother overall process and greater certainty around completion dates.
Choosing the right builder and modules
Selecting a reputable supplier involves evaluating engineering standards, material warranties, and aftercare services. Prospective buyers should request case studies and references to verify performance under real conditions. It’s wise to examine the modular options for floor plans, ceiling heights, and storage solutions to tailor the space to everyday routines. Collaboration with designers who understand energy efficiency and acoustic performance can significantly enhance living quality in a compact footprint.
